Understanding The Iron Triangle
The Iron Triangle consists of three key factors: cost, time, and quality. These elements are interrelated, meaning that changing one factor often affects the others. For example, if you want to enhance the quality of a project within a limited budget, you may have to extend the timeline. Generally, it is challenging to achieve all three aspects concurrently; thus, decision-makers must balance these priorities to meet project objectives.

Strategies for Teaching The Iron Triangle
1. Real-world examples: Provide scenarios from different sectors (e.g., healthcare, infrastructure) where the Iron Triangle has been utilized in decision-making. Encourage discussions around these examples and how they illustrate the challenges of balancing cost, time, and quality.
2. Group activities: Divide students into teams and assign them roles as project managers who must decide on priorities related to each aspect of the Iron Triangle. Emphasize that ideal solutions rarely exist in real life; thus, trade-offs are necessary.
3. Case studies: Utilize case studies demonstrating relevant decision-making processes in public policy projects and how various aspects of the Iron Triangle were managed in these situations. Analyze the results and encourage students to deliberate on possible alternative solutions.
4. Role-play: Organize role-play activities where students assume roles as decision-makers involved in a public project. This hands-on approach enables them to simulate a real-life situation, fostering comprehension of the Iron Triangle beyond mere theoretical learning.
5. Guest lectures: Invite professionals from related fields, such as project managers or public administrators, to share their first-hand experiences of applying the Iron Triangle in their work. This enriches students’ learning and provides them with real-world perspectives.
